Unless Panchayati Raj Institutions are fully  empowered as has been promised by the Government, the Government may have to face disenchanted Sarpanch, Panchs everywhere in the State. The key to empowerment lies in 73rd Amendment Act. The ‘Panchayati Raj Act J&K is  like a toothless tiger without 73rd Amendment.
If 73rd Amendment has been in use in other state, why does not in Jammu & Kashmir. Panchs, Sarpanch and the opposition parties have been demanding the inclusion of this Act right from the day Panchayat polling process was set in motion in the State.
The people of the State even after facing militant threats whole-heartedly participated  in the polls with the intention that powers which include financial powers will be executed at grass  root level. But that did not happen so far. This has disappointed the people. The Government should live by its promise and incorporate 73rd Amendment Act in the Panchayati Raj Act without further delay.
